CVE-2025-4831: TOTOLINK A702R/A3002R/A3002RU HTTP POST Request formSiteSurveyProfile buffer overflow
A vulnerability, which was classified as critical, was found in TOTOLINK A702R, A3002R and A3002RU 3.0.0-B20230809.1615. This affects an unknown part of the file /boafrm/formSiteSurveyProfile of the component HTTP POST Request Handler. The manipulation of the argument submit-url leads to buffer overflow. It is possible to initiate the attack remotely. The exploit has been disclosed to the public and may be used.
